Playlist for What's This Called? with your host Ricardo Wang for Saturday, February 2nd, 2008 from Noon to 1 PM Pacific Time on KPSU.

DOWNLOAD AS MP3 OR PLAY STREAM HERE!


1450 AM
in the Portland OR/Vancouver WA metro area
98.1 FM on the Portland State University campus

Artist -Song/Track - Album - Recording Label

David Lee Roth/Ennio Morricone - "Running With The Mash-Up" - Ha Ha - Heh
Von Sudenfed - "Serious Brainskin" - Tromatic Reflexxions - Domino Recording Co.
Mortal Engines - "Leviathan" - Pressure Vessel - indie
Gregory Lenczycki - "Retina Volt Stream" - The Throne of Drones - Sombient
Peter Jefferies - "Red Sky" - Closed Circuit - Emporer Jones
Sun City Girls - "Levitating Orchards" - Valentines from Matahari - Majora
Lee Ranaldo - "The Singing Bridge of Memphis, Brooklyn Bridge Version/The Ceolcanth" - I Am the Resurrection: A Tribute To John Fahey - Vanguard
Yma Sumac - "Taki Rari" - Ultra-Lounge - Capitol
Vinicio Capossela - "Medusa Cha Cha Cha" - Ovunque Proteggi - Warner
The Hafler Trio - "Placing the Seed (extract)" - Sometimes Silence is an Answer - Soleilmoon
Negativland - "Methods of Torture" - Escape from Noise - Seeland
Autechre - "Bine" - Confield - Warp
Thunderbolt Pagoda - "Horizon on Fire (studio mix)" - forthcoming - indie
